"""OphthalmoCapture — Download Component
Provides individual and bulk download buttons for the labeling package.
Uses @st.dialog modals to warn about incomplete labeling before download.
"""
import streamlit as st
import pandas as pd
import config
from i18n import t
from services.export_service import (
export_single_image,
export_full_session,
get_session_summary,
export_huggingface_csv,
export_jsonl,
)
# ── Helpers ──────────────────────────────────────────────────────────────────
def _get_image_missing_info(img: dict) -> list[str]:
"""Return a list of human-readable items that are missing for one image."""
missing = []
if img.get("label") is None:
missing.append(t("missing_categorical"))
elif img["label"] == "Cataract":
locs = img.get("locs_data", {})
for field in config.LOCS_FIELDS:
fid = field["field_id"]
if fid not in locs:
missing.append(t("missing_locs", field=field["label"]))
if not img.get("transcription"):
missing.append(t("missing_voice"))
return missing
